Canary deploys at Ferrowick run through the Gatemark pipeline. Rules: a canary gets 5% of traffic for 30 minutes minimum; promotion is blocked if error rate exceeds baseline by 0.5% or p99 latency regresses 10%. Security-relevant changes additionally require a signed manifest and a passing policy scan — no manual overrides without two approvals from the platform team. Rollback is automatic on any gate failure. The complete gating matrix, including which checks are advisory versus blocking, is maintained on this internal page:

runbook for badug-kadup: https://confluence.zemvarlabs.internal/projects/browse/display/projects/bd1b

### Step 4 — Cut over the user module

Drain traffic from the Monocoque monolith's `/users` routes. Deploy `usersvc` to the Fernhollow cluster. Verify health endpoint returns 200 on both replicas. Flip the router flag `USERSVC_ENABLED=true`. Do not remove the monolith handlers yet; they stay as fallback for one release. The new service still needs to mint session tokens compatible with the monolith, so it shares the signing secret. Add that secret to the env file on the next line.

sealed setting: VAULT_KEY5=0924b

## Who to ping about GiftNote

Welcome aboard! GiftNote is our donation-receipt mailer for the Larchfield Fund. Template tweaks go to the comms folks; delivery failures and bounce weirdness go to the platform crew. Don't push template changes on Fridays — receipts batch over the weekend. For anything GiftNote-related, start with the address below.

billing contact of kaweg-tajeg = drudor.lamion.oliath@torvalabs.test

## Formula sandbox tuning

User-supplied formulas in Gridmoor execute inside a restricted interpreter with hard ceilings on time, memory, and call depth. Reviewers should confirm any change to these ceilings is justified in the PR description, since raising them widens the abuse surface. Defaults were chosen from production traces. The current limits are as follows.

limits module of tafog-fawip:
WEIGHTS = {
    "julix": 57,
    "lamys": 992,
    "kasvan": 209,
    "quenok": 750,
    "alddor": 259,
    "oliath": 1009,
    "wenix": 815,
}